Korean hips revision clavicle and ribs and ffs 2 years post op also lower face lift at MFO 's alumni's place in Istanbul. Next stop suporn. In Jan 2026 by Things123455 in Transgender_Surgeries

[–]Things123455[S] 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Ok it's tough surgery when I woke up from clavicle I swore and shouted 😳😣 poor nurses I bought them chocs for putting up with that🙏. It took like 20 minutes for the pain medication to really work fully and then 2 weeks you need to hardly move your arms. So getting up is hard work! Also hips at the same time and ribs can be done but prepare for it and between that and the pain medication you will be fine. You should plan and behave to reduce movement to minimum to maintain bodily hygiene for 4 weeks. And lay down as much as you can. It's also expensive but yeah they do it all there in that hospital, obviously if you are doing multiple things in one trip then you can ask for a discount. It is a skeletal specialist hospital, they have alot of elderly patients and tends to be more busy in the winter months because of this but we get a private room and they have loads of staff. The language barrier, food and the 4 walls of the hospital can get very boring but the patient coordinator speaks good English. If you do go dm me, I'm going back to the office tomorrow after 3 weeks but I would suggest 4 weeks is better as I know a two of us internal patients have gone back for revision on the hips because of swelling or infection and I went back for aesthetic, referred pain and I also had a screw loose 🤣🤣... Korean hips revision clavicle and ribs and ffs 2 years post op also lower face lift at MFO 's alumni's place in Istanbul. Next stop suporn. In Jan 2026 by Things123455 in Transgender_Surgeries

[–]Things123455[S] 3 points4 points  (0 children)

Right so I have been back for revisions on the hips, first time I didn't like the result and second time pain was referred from my spine so had that done and updated to the larger hard implant then after 9 months I managed to somehow make the screw come loose that holds the titanium element. So I went back again and the Dr replaced for the latest silicone design and new titanium and I have extra screws as well. While going for revisions I have had my ribs Augmentation and clavicle reduction and a prolapsed disk operated on. The last visit was 3 weeks ago. For international patients they are finding we get mobile too quickly before healing and this increases the risk of complication.

So I would say stay in bed and chill for 2 weeks and then limit sitting in the 3rd week and use the compression bandage on the hip lightly and immobile. When you have BA they take ages to heal and it isn't connected to your legs, because of walking about you extend the recovery process and in this time can cause complications.

That said the latest design has come along way in it is much better for me. They have never once charged me for revision but I have paid my own flights and probably spent 6 weeks of the last 2 years in hospital bed and then there is the home recovering and time off work and exercise 😉
